Atlanta Turf Conditions

Atlanta's Fulton County clay is dense and compacted, especially in developed commercial zones across Buckhead and Midtown. This soil type drains poorly, which means natural grass struggles through our humid summers and turns brown during drought stretches—something we see regularly. Your lot size, sun exposure, and foot traffic patterns matter enormously. A shaded property near the BeltLine has different needs than a south-facing parking area on a busy street. Most commercial properties in Atlanta's core neighborhoods sit on small to medium lots, which means every square foot counts for aesthetics and functionality. Installation on clay requires proper base preparation and drainage solutions; we don't just lay turf on compacted earth and hope for the best. HOA restrictions vary by neighborhood, but most commercial areas and business districts have minimal turf regulations—the focus is on maintenance-free appearance and durability. Winter greens up quickly in Atlanta, which artificial turf delivers consistently. Summer heat isn't a problem; modern fibrillated blades resist UV damage and stay comfortable underfoot even in July.

How much water will artificial turf actually save my Atlanta commercial property?

Most commercial installations in Georgia save 70–80% on irrigation costs annually. With Atlanta's clay-heavy soil and summer drought cycles, natural turf demands constant watering to stay presentable. Artificial turf needs zero irrigation, zero runoff, and zero water bill increases. For a mid-size parking area or landscaped entrance, you're looking at thousands of dollars saved each year.

What's the timeline for installing turf on my Atlanta commercial lot?

A typical mid-size commercial installation takes 3–5 days, depending on site size and drainage prep required for Atlanta's clay soil. We handle base grading, drainage setup, and final turf install in one coordinated project. Most properties are fully functional by the end of week one.
